The ears

The first part of my elephant I wish to understand is its ears. How does the community listen? Or more accurately, how do people in the community listen to each other?

They have many opportunities: journals and other publications; conferences and workshops; e-mail and list servers, discussion groups and bulletin boards; telephones, telephone conferencing and video conferencing; web-based systems of content management, instant messaging, and project management. And of course talking to each other face to face in pairs or larger groups.

I plan to invite people to capture their communications within their community, particularly those that relate to collaboration - working together in some way. And I also want them to tell me how they think they communicate, and see if is the same as or different from what actually happens.

The data should reveal communications activity across a range of media and opportunities; and I plan to follow the activity over one or two years if possible, as collaborative purposes change, to see if communication changes too.

My first blind man will be listening.
